Output a38f62ff736aa5fef83f7c7dca6b8d060b13a9b279cc878d282bca2ed04bfa93:1

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5c985cd08582c1221509343a49645ef9b1a53c OP_EQUAL
address
34NGSjPwmyFWetS2p6d3KZDoJ8gAYBk5pR
transaction
a38f62ff736aa5fef83f7c7dca6b8d060b13a9b279cc878d282bca2ed04bfa93
confirmations
403249
spent
true